Comparing Pool Cleaning Approaches: Advantages and Disadvantages

When investigating pool cleaning methods, it is critical to appreciate the positives and negatives of each approach. Manual cleaning supports in-depth and precise care but can be labor-intensive and time-consuming. Automatic cleaners grant accessibility and productivity, though they may not reach every corner of the pool.

Chemical products are powerful in sanitizing, but incorrect handling can lead to disrupted chemical balance. In distinction, natural cleaning methods, like using biological enzymes, are eco-friendly but may require repeated treatments to maintain clarity.

Robotic cleaners are gaining traction, offering an equilibrium between self-operation and performance yet may carry a considerable upfront cost. In conclusion, which cleaning technique you opt for copyrights on your budget, your schedule, and your needs. Understanding the positives and negatives allows those with pools to decide intelligently and protect their water quality so it remains sparkling and attractive.

Seasonal Servicing Tips

Routine pool maintenance is important for maintaining a secure and inviting aquatic environment. Periodic maintenance suggestions suggest that pool operators should book maintenance sessions based on the unique requirements of their pool and local climate. In spring, a deep cleaning is essential to remove accumulated debris over winter. During the summer period, weekly maintenance are commonly suggested to regulate increased usage and algae formation. As autumn approaches, frequent maintenance may be needed to manage leaves and other organic substances. In winter, if the pool is not in use, bi-weekly maintenance can help avoid complications like freezing and algae buildup. Following these seasonal suggestions ensures peak pool wellness, safety, and pleasure throughout the year.

What Complications Result Without Periodic Maintenance?

Disregarding pool care can produce numerous challenges that affect both the wellbeing and gratification of the swimming setting. Lacking habitual cleaning, debris accumulates, generating a sanctuary for algae growth and bacteria, which can pose dangers to health to swimmers. Also, unbalanced chemical levels may produce skin irritation, discomfort in the eyes, or even worse health complications.

Throughout time, the pool's filtration timely resource unit can become obstructed, reducing its efficiency and producing hazy water. Also, neglecting routine checks can cause structural damage, including fissures in the pool surface and corrosion of metal components. This deterioration not only impacts aesthetics but can also lead to costly repairs. In all, failing to maintain a pool undermines its working capacity and security measures, ultimately decreasing the enjoyment factor of swimming and amplifying enduring financial burden for the owner. Routine care is essential for keeping a clean, safe, and enjoyable pool environment.

Standard Pool Cleaning Missteps to Avoid

Regular maintenance is crucial for avoiding a variety of problems, but even diligent pool owners can make mistakes during the cleaning process. One common error is failing to monitor chemical levels before maintenance. Improper balance can lead to algae growth or cloudy water, undermining the cleaning effort. Additionally, using the wrong tools can damage surfaces; for instance, metal brushes can scuff vinyl liners.

Yet another frequent mistake involves neglecting the skimmer and pump baskets. Failing to empty these can impede water flow and reduce cleaning efficiency. Some owners also fail to regular filter maintenance, which results in degraded performance and higher energy bills.

In conclusion, neglecting regular cleaning can create a accumulation of debris and contaminants. By avoiding these common pitfalls, pool owners can ensure their cleaning routines are effective, keeping their swimming areas crystal clear and inviting for all.
